AGENDA

ZONING BOARD OF APPEALS

THURSDAY, OCTOBER 10, 2024

PRE-MEETING/CASE REVIEW –

11:00 A.M.

11th FLOOR –

CENTRAL CONFERENCE ROOM

1:00 P.M. - PUBLIC HEARING

LEGISLATIVE CHAMBER – LC LEVEL

OMAHA/DOUGLAS CIVIC CENTER -

1819 FARNAM STREET

 

NEW CASES:

Waiver of Section 55-503 – Variance to the permitted use regulations in the GI District to allow Religious Assembly not otherwise permitted; 4223 S. 120th St.

Waiver of Section 55-163 & 55-166 – Variance to allow a Warehousing and Distribution (limited) use, not otherwise permitted in the R3 district for an existing storage building; 13612 Miami St. & 13611 Corby St.

Waiver of Section 55-105 – Variance to the permitted use regulations of the DR District to allow a Two-Family Residential use not otherwise permitted, in order to allow for the construction of a primary residence; 8809 N. 48th St.

Waiver of Section 55-503 – Variance to the permitted use regulations of the GI District to allow for a Heavy Industry use (batch plant) not otherwise permitted to expand its current operations onto the site; 6002 N. 89th Cir. And 6205 & 6225 N. 87th Cir.
